WayLink
WayLink Systems Corporation is a U.S. based technology company specializing in automated highway and roadway data collection and analysis. Its digital-based products include automated pavement cracking and rutting survey, inertial laser-based longitudinal pavement profiling and roughness measurement, pavement right-of-way imaging, positioning data collections (including precision gyro, high-frequency differential GPS receiver, Distance Measurement Instrument, and Inertial Measurement Unit (IMU)).
Michael O’Hara
Oklahoma State University
Major: Civil Engineering
As an intern, Michael assisted with the development of a data collecting system that can be installed onto a roadway vehicle. The vehicle is driven over city streets, bridges and highways at up to 60mph to collect a high resolution 3D image of the road surface. The vehicle collects other data while doing this to get a grand picture of the road surface and its environment. At the lab, several employees are working on software to improve the data collection system. The WayLink system as a whole presents a unique engineering challenge in several different fields of engineering including but not limited to civil engineering, mechanical engineering, and software engineering.
